Handover for the Crashbin pipeline. It ingests crash reports from the Petrel mobile app, batches them, and ships summaries to triage. Watch the queue depth; anything over 10k means the parser is stuck. Restarting the worker usually fixes it. Talk to Dara for access. Current production config follows.

config for hahif-yahop:
[istox]
port = 9000
region = central-3
host = istox.zarqelnet.test
team = noviel
timeout_ms = 500
retries = 5

Welcome aboard. Quick rules for the Thistlekit shared component library while you're on call. We follow strict semver: breaking changes only land in majors, and majors ship quarterly. Consumer apps pin to minor ranges, so a bad patch release can break half the org—treat publish failures or yanked versions as P2. Never republish a version number, ever. If someone asks for a backport, route them to the maintainers channel. The full versioning policy and release calendar are on the internal page here.

dashboard of tahop-fahof = https://harbor.tolvaqnet.example/secrets/merge_requests/board/issue/merge_requests/pipeline/secrets/ecb30ed86a55c001a77f6cb9

Hey — welcome aboard! Quick handover on PortionPal, our recipe-scaling calculator. The tricky bit is non-linear ingredients: salt, yeast, and leavening scale on a curve, not a multiplier, and the curve tables live in `scaling/curves.yaml`. Don't touch rounding logic without running the bakery snapshot tests; tiny changes cascade badly. Metric/imperial conversion happens *after* scaling, never before. Everything else is boring CRUD. Full notes on the curve tables are on the internal page.

operations page: https://jenkins.zemvarcloud.local/job/merge_requests/repo/build/73930b4b30f0a8ed

Issue: intermittent NXDOMAIN on auth.inner.grelvane.net during account recovery flows. Cause: resolver cache flapping on the Torvik edge nodes. Mitigation: pin recovery services to the secondary resolver pool; restart stub resolvers in order. If the recovery console rejects your session mid-flow, re-authenticate to the Keyhold vault. Vault access requires the on-call recovery passphrase, rotated monthly. Current passphrase follows:

strongbox words: zorox-holix